Atletico Madrid v Liverpool: Away ticket details LFC Liverpool FC has released the following ticket details for the Champions League fixture with Atletico Madrid at Estadio Metropolitano on Tuesday February 18. The match is scheduled to kick off at 9pm local time. LFC has received an allocation of 3,328 tickets for supporters to purchase. We have also received a further allocation of 200 top-category seats that, in line with UEFA guidelines, will be used as part of the players' allocation and staff, travelling club staff and VIPs. Ticket prices Adults: £60 Sale dates Hospitality Members: Sir Kenny Dalglish Stand executive box holders, premium level and centenary club members should contact the hospitality department on 0151 264 2222, option 2. Disabled supporters: Within the allocation, we have received 11 pairs of wheelchair and personal assistant tickets. Tickets will be available to season ticket holders and official Members who recorded previous ticket purchases for wheelchair bays for UEFA Champions League away fixtures - please click here for full details. All other supporters The below sales will take place online only and you may have to queue at times. Tickets will be available to season ticket holders and official Members based on UEFA Champions League away fixtures recorded during the 2019-20 and 2018-19 seasons: FC Salzburg (2019-20) KRC Genk (2019-20) SSC Napoli (2019-20) FC Barcelona (2018-19) FC Porto (2018-19) Bayern Munich (2018-19) Paris Saint-Germain (2018-19) Red Star Belgrade (2018-19) SSC Napoli (2018-19) Three or more games: from 8.15am on Tuesday January 14 until 10.30am on Wednesday January 15. Supporters are guaranteed a ticket during this sale and can purchase one ticket per person, up to a maximum of 10 tickets per transaction. The following sales will take place on a first come, first served basis and supporters can purchase one ticket per person up to a maximum of four tickets per transaction. Two or more games: from 11am on Wednesday January 15. Tickets in the above sale are subject to availability and no guarantee can be given that tickets will be available to all who apply.
